Know the facts. Prevent HIV. ❤️

HIV can be transmitted through specific routes — including unprotected s*x, transfusion of infected blood or blood products, sharing contaminated needles/syringes, and from an HIV-positive mother to her child.

The good news? Prevention is possible. Stay informed, choose safer practices, get tested when recommended, and seek accurate information.

HIV prevention starts with simple, informed choices. ❤️

Use condoms correctly and consistently, never share needles, use tested and safe blood, and get tested early during pregnancy.

Protect yourself. Protect your partner. Protect your future.

Intensified IEC Campaign 3.0 launched in Goa

Goa State AIDS Control Society (Goa SACS), in coordination with the National AIDS Control Organisation (NACO), launched the Intensified IEC Campaign 3.0 on 12th August 2026, coinciding with International Youth Day.

The launch programme was held at Usgao-Ganjem Village Panchayat Hall, Usgao, Goa, in the presence of Chief Guest Hon’ble Health Minister Shri Vishwajit P. Rane, and Guest of Honour Shri Yetindra Maralkar, IAS, Secretary, Health.

Dr. Jasmine Brenda Pinto, Project Director, Goa SACS, delivered the formal welcome, Dr. Tanvi Pednekar, Psychiatrist, North District Hospital (Asilo), Mapusa delivered the keynote address, while Shri Umakant Sawant, JD (IEC), Goa SACS, delivered the vote of thanks.

The winners of the Poster Competition and Street Play Competition were felicitated and awarded prizes by the Hon’ble Health Minister. An IEC Van was also launched to carry HIV/AIDS and STI awareness messages across Goa during the campaign.

The two-month campaign will focus on promoting awareness about HIV transmission and prevention, HIV and STI services, the HIV and AIDS (Prevention & Control) Act, 2017, the National AIDS Toll-Free Helpline 1097, and the importance of addressing stigma and discrimination.
